Rain Gutter Clearing in Longmont, CO
Rain gutter clearing services involve removing debris such as leaves, twigs, and dirt from the gutters and downspouts to ensure proper water flow. This service is essential for maintaining the integrity of a property’s roofing and foundation, especially in areas prone to heavy seasonal debris. Projects typically include cleaning gutters on residential homes, multi-story buildings, and other structures with accessible gutter systems. Homeowners often want to understand the scope of cleaning, whether it includes flushing the system, inspecting for damage, or addressing blockages that could lead to water overflow or damage.
Property owners usually request gutter clearing to prevent water from spilling over the sides during storms or heavy rain, which can cause erosion or water damage to exterior walls and landscaping. Before requesting this service, it’s helpful to know the height and accessibility of the gutters, as well as any specific concerns about blockages or damage. Properly maintained gutters contribute to the longevity of a property’s roofing and foundation, making regular clearing an important part of property upkeep.

Rain Gutter Clearing Questions
What is gutter clearing? Gutter clearing involves removing leaves, debris, and obstructions from downspouts and gutters to ensure proper water flow.
Why should gutters be cleaned regularly? Regular cleaning helps prevent water damage, foundation issues, and pest infestations caused by clogged gutters.
How often should gutters be serviced? Gutter maintenance is typically recommended at least twice a year, especially in fall and spring.
What signs indicate gutters need cleaning? Overflowing water, sagging gutters, or visible debris are common signs that gutters require attention.
